FBref’s journey began with a focus on Europe’s top domestic leagues – England, France, Germany, Italy, and Spain – alongside the United States’ MLS. Since then, the site has expanded dramatically, bringing you data from over 40 countries, plus domestic cups and youth leagues. Crucially, this expansion included major international tournaments like the UEFA Champions League and, of course, the UEFA European Championship. If you’re seeking historical stats, current team performance metrics, or individual player data from past and present Euros, FBref is your go-to resource.

What sets FBref apart is its commitment to providing not just basic statistics, but also advanced analytical data. In collaboration with Opta, a leader in sports data, FBref delivers metrics like expected Goals (xG), expected Assists (xA), progressive passing, and duels for a wide range of competitions. This advanced data capability extends to major international tournaments, giving you a richer, more nuanced understanding of UEFA Euro performances.
